One of the top use cases for VCF Operations is VM Rightsizing, our ability to make recommendations on the size of your VMs. We've discussed this a few times over the years:


A recent ask was to find the minimum rightsizing recommendations for VMs over time, to be used in a conservative approach to rightsizing. Here's how we did it.


My first thought was a Super Metric using the "min" function, but Super Metrics don't support time series data (data over time). So, I used a View Transformation, here's how.



I selected the VM vCPU and Memory Rightsizing Reduction Metrics and used the Transformation to find their minimum over time. You can configure the timeframe over which that minimum is determined in step 3 or you can tell the List View Widget to use Dashboard Time.



As you can see I've built a Dashboard with more information about the VMs in question. Once you select a VM you get to see the vCPU and Memory reduction recommendations over time, including their minimums over that time. This is a good way to take a conservative approach to rightsizing VMs. Hope this was helpful, enjoy!
